I just thought I would report that I finally figured out and solved my authorization problem with Rapture Pro in Windows.tonedef71 wrote:For me, Rapture Pro is stuck in demo mode, and so I am not inspired to do anything with it. Even with the 2.0.1 update, I am still not able to get Rapture Pro authorized on my 64-bit Windows 8.1 machine. Cakewalk Support has tried to help me get the product authorized, but so far, none of their suggestions have worked; Cakewalk support has not gotten back to me with any new suggestions to try in quite some time; I think they are stumped and fresh out of ideas.
Apparently, Rapture Pro performs a lookup to the Windows Registry to retrieve the location of the Cakewalk Command Center application so that it can call out to the utility to validate the current status of the registration. Previously, I had a disagreement with the Cakewalk Command Center installer: it did not allow me to select where the utility was to be installed, and I did not like the default installation location, so I manually relocated the utility after the installation had completed. Unfortunately, I did not realize that the installer for the Cakewalk Command Center had recorded the installation location to the Windows Registry so that other Cakewalk applications (e.g. Rapture Pro) could find it and call it. After manually updating the setting of the Cakewalk Command Center installation location in the Windows Registry (to be what it should be for my custom system configuration), Rapture Pro was able to validate my registration just fine:
To their credit, Cakewalk Product Support did try to help me with my authorization problem, but I guess they did not consider that the problem could be due to Rapture Pro not being able to find and run Cakewalk Command Center. I cannot fault the support folks; the Rapture Pro application neither tries to report the problem overtly (with a popup dialog) nor covertly (by writing an error message to a log file); the blame there lies with the bakers who coded the authorization logic in Rapture Pro.Windows Registry Editor Version 5.00
[H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Cakewalk Music Software\Command Center]
"Path"="my\\path\\to\\Cakewalk-Command-Center.exe"
[H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Wow6432Node\Cakewalk Music Software\Command Center]
"Path"="my\\path\\to\\Cakewalk\\Command Center\\Cakewalk-Command-Center.exe"
